Finchley Road & Frognal to Seaham by train

A train trip from Finchley Road & Frognal to Seaham takes about 5hrs 32 mins on average, covering roughly 232 miles (373 kilometres). With around 25 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£26.30,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Finchley Road & Frognal to Seaham start from as little as £26.30

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Finchley Road & Frognal to Seaham start from £89.60 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Finchley Road & Frognal to Seaham are available for £202.20 one way

Station Facilities and Amenities

The ticket office at Finchley Road & Frognal is open from Monday to Friday, 07:30 to 10:00, offering an accessible ticket collection service via well-maintained machines. It's reassuring to know that these machines are equipped with an induction loop to assist those with hearing impairments. Unfortunately, though, Smartcards are not issued or validated at this station, and there's no luggage storage facility. The seating area on the platforms ensures comfort while you wait for your train, with waiting rooms available on weekdays and Saturdays.

In terms of accessibility, while the ticket office boasts step-free access, the station lacks ramps for train access and doesn't have accessible toilets. However, CCTV ensures a degree of safety and security around the station. Transport Links and Onward Travel

Looking beyond the station, the links to other modes of public transport provide numerous onward travel options. Finchley Road underground station is a pleasant 10-minute walk away. Bus stops are conveniently located on Canfield Gardens and Broadhurst Gardens, offering services to areas like Camden Road and Richmond. The proximity of West Hampstead facilitates easy transitions to Luton and Gatwick airports, catering to the avid traveler in need of connecting flights. Key Amenities and Accessibility at Seaham Station

Seaham Station offers convenient and straightforward facilities for a smooth transit experience. Though it may not boast a large ticket office, it provides ticket machines that make collecting pre-purchased tickets a breeze. Located in the waiting shelter on the Sunderland-bound platform, the ticket machines accept card payments only. While there is no waiting room, seating area, or refreshment services, the station ensures accessibility with step-free entry and ramped access to the platforms. Plus, for those needing extra assistance when boarding, you can request help through the Passenger Assist service.
